How much is the rebate for solar panels in Busbys Flat, NSW
The Australian Federal Government has incentives for Busbys Flat homeowners to install solar. They give "STCs" (small-scale technology certificates) to people who add a solar power system to their home.
The government divides the country into "Zones" depending on the rated solar potential. You get more support or less depending on your zone. Busbys Flat is in Climate Zone 3 which has a rating of 1.382.
This means a 10 kW solar system installed in Busbys Flat during 2024 would give you 96 ST Certificates worth $3830.40 (at an STC price of $39.90 each).
If you wait until 2025 for your panels the rebate in Busbys Flat will be reduced. It goes down every year.

Here's about how much Solar Energy falls on Busbys Flat by month. The maximum is 6.55 kWh/M2 in December. The minimum is 2.98 kWh/M2 during June.
| Month | Energy MJ/M2 | kWh/M2 |
|---|---|---|
| Jan | 23.48 | 6.52 |
| Feb | 20.71 | 5.75 |
| Mar | 17.93 | 4.98 |
| Apr | 15.29 | 4.25 |
| May | 12.29 | 3.41 |
| Jun | 10.74 | 2.98 |
| Jul | 12.07 | 3.35 |
| Aug | 15.31 | 4.25 |
| Sep | 18.79 | 5.22 |
| Oct | 21.01 | 5.84 |
| Nov | 22.95 | 6.37 |
| Dec | 23.57 | 6.55 |
Figures from the weather station at Alstonville, which is approximately 64.2 km from Busbys Flat.
Busbys Flat, NSW is in the 2469 postcode area which has around 777 solar installations under 10 kW and about 824 total installations including large scale solar. As a comparison there are roughly 148143 small solar installations in greater Brisbane.
With an estimated 2278 households in the 2469 area that gives a small solar installation (average size around 4.14 kW) for about every 2.9 dwellings.

Solar Panel Angle in Busbys Flat
It is generally recommended to angle your panels at about 29.0° from the horizontal in this area - facing north, although your power usage patterns could alter this - if you are out all day.
